    (Took Out 12/25/21 SA @ 6:45pm): This palace was the szechuan food king on this Christmas evening! On Day 6 of my vacation as I visited a very dear friend for the Christmas and New Year holidays, it was Christmas Day, our initial dinner plan was postponed, and it was definitely slim pickings with so many businesses closed except for King Szechuan Palace. Having earlier watched "A Christmas Story", it felt appropriate to have Chinese takeout food - "fra ra ra ra ra... ra ra ra raaa"! I've made a concerted effort to try various types of food while on this vacation. How was this non-traditional Christmas meal as we celebrated the birth of Jesus Christ!? PURCHASE Qt. General Tso's Chicken ($13.00): This reminded me more of orange chicken, a large portion of lightly spicy tender chicken bits on a small bed of broccoli florets that was a welcoming start to our meal https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=POorKcMJLo8q03S6302klA&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w. Broccoli In Garlic Sauce ($11.95): I loved broccoli, so these bushels of crowns bathed in sweet and tangy garlic sauce was a treat especially over some rice https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=VDwOgdLyiPVck1eRALKSlQ&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w. Sautéed String Beans ($11.95): Another large portion, I wanted more vegetables since I lacked any while on this vacation. These were fresh with a light crisp rather than a limp even with all the sauce while the chili flakes gave it some nice heat https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=Kuhz7SYl-wyv6OCgPMATbQ&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w. Qt. Pork Lo Mein ($9.00): With oodles of noodles and a lot of pork pieces, it seemed there were more flecks than bite-size bits. There were minimal vegetables, but thankfully the noodles separated easily although not very oily https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=OASXiO7jczl9jSZ3xbULKA&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w. Qt. Hot & Sour Soup ($4.50): The price was incredible! This was filled with a ton of bamboo shoots, egg, mushrooms, and tofu slices, while the broth was the perfect combination of hot, savory, and sour that helped warm my body in the evening's very cold temperature - an absolutely wonderful soup https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=XoLZ3WpG3vJfNR05BorN8g&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w! Steamed White Rice (COMP w/Entrée): Provided with each entrée (three total), it was always cool when they included rice without being charged. Standard rice with nothing truly special but paired well with the chicken and vegetables https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=qJVR6CeSnzl0lOwSRzyWng&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w. SERVICE I initially called several times with no answers, so we took a chance and walked to the restaurants with hopes they were open. Thankfully, they were but were slammed by various delivery orders and behind schedule based on a limited staff (I saw a total of three workers). Regardless, a stressed but cool woman took my in-person order, I paid, and decided to explore the neighborhood just to get out of their hair. We returned thirty minutes later to less of a crowd and our food all packed and ready to go. With a "happy holidays" to them, we were off to enjoy our Christmas meal. Under pressure, they did a great job for us! PARKING (FREE; N/A in this instance) We walked, so parking wasn't an issue. Otherwise, there appeared to be plenty of spots along the main drag of Reservoir Ave. and all surrounding streets - 'nuff said. ATMOSPHERE, DÉCOR, AMBIENCE A no-frills small restaurant with a short waiting area, a couple chairs/tables, and a thick protective plastic that separated the order/pick-up counter and the open kitchen because of COVID-19. There were printed menus on the counter https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=A_-pX3-KVyFSNeg7RcTKdQ&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w with some random food pictures without prices on the wall above the counter. Plenty of natural lighting came through the large front windows and door while soul-sucking fluorescent electric ceiling lights filled in the rest. There were no TVs or background music. https://www.yelp.com/user_local_photos?select=rYI7tk4CPDtLQ1jLi2kqkw&userid=8jVT2inwc8GIQ6sH2UG9Vw ATTIRE Temperatures were in the 30s, so I was bundled-up from head-to-toe. Otherwise, this place was totally casual, so I would normally be in a t-shirt, boardshorts, and flip-flops. OVERALL I was extremely grateful that King Szechuan Palace was open this Christmas night. The food was tasty (minor modifications), huge portions, comparable prices, vast menu selection, and very good service all-things considered. And, it was always a pleasure to support small local mom & pop businesses like this one. I found complete value based on the prices, service, and experience noted above (TOTAL paid experience was around $56.00 BEFORE any discounts and/or tip). And, they accepted my credit card of choice... AMEX! 5.0 STARS

    This is our absolute favorite szechuan chinese takeout place in the area. We order from here at least 2 times a month and our favorite go-to dish is Chongquing Chicken. It is this spicy chicken dish that is cooked with sichuan chicken pepper which have a tingling effect on the tongue. If you like spicy food, this is a must try. We also like their dumplings and scalion pancakes. The cashew chicken is another go-to dish. They typically deliver within 30-45 min and sometimes it's even less than that. The staff is also funny and nice. Once they had messed up our order and we called them, first they denied messing it up and then they told us we can get that same dish for free "next time". They didn't take our name down or anything. We never took them up on the offer but it was nice of them to say that we could do that (although we are not even sure if they would actually have given us the free dish next time).

    Back when my friends lived in the area, we used to order from this place all the time. It's been a couple years since they moved from there, but when the craving hit and nothing nearby would satisfy me, I decided to take a 30 minute drive to see if King Szechuan was like how I remembered it to be, and I'm happy to say they're still great! For takeout Chinese, the Szechuan flavors here are no joke. Tongue numbing spiciness. I wouldn't get their Americanized Chinese food because you don't order from here for that. You get the authentic dishes and they are surprisingly authentic. My go to dishes are fish fillet with bean curd. I haven't been able to find a place that satisfies my cravings like this place does unless I go into the city. Honey chicken is also very good. Chicken and eggplant is also great. This time I got baby bok choy with black mushroom, fish fillet bean curd, and beef in tripe in chili oil. Everything was exactly how I remembered it to be. I would highly recommend this place to anyone looking for strong Szechuan flavors. Honestly a deal for the quality they provide at the prices. Will be back if I'm ever in the area and craving Szechuan! Don't get Americanized food here! They're Szechuan is the real deal!
